Distance From Lube Airfield to Nursultan Nazarbayev International Airport

The distance from Lube Airfield () to Nursultan Nazarbayev International Airport (NQZ) is 1978 miles or 3183 kilometers or 1718 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Lube ( Latvia ) to Nur-Sultan ( Kazakhstan )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Lube and Nur-Sultan takes around 4 hours 32 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Lube Airfield, Lube, Latvia to Nursultan Nazarbayev International Airport, Nur-Sultan, Kazakhstan is 4 hours 32 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
